Arcadia Man, 22, Convicted of Second-Degree Murder After Shooting

UPDATE: A DeSoto County jury has just convicted a 22-year-old Arcadia man of second-degree murder in a shocking case that involved him firing into a car 15 times, resulting in one death and one serious injury. The jury delivered their verdict earlier today, confirming the gravity of this violent act.

The defendant, whose name has not been released pending sentencing, opened fire during an altercation, striking multiple individuals inside the vehicle. The incident, which occurred on July 15, 2023, has left the local community in shock and mourning, as the victim has been identified as James Smith, aged 30, who tragically lost his life due to the attack.
